North Carolina was coming in as a -4.5 favorite in their Sweet 16 game against the Alabama Crimson Tide.

Alabama took care of giant killer Grand Canyon to put an end to that team's Cinderella run.

Mark Sears had 26 points and 12 rebounds, Mouhamed Dioubate scored all nine of his points in the final 5 1/2 minutes,

“I was just playing hard and I got lost in the game, honestly. I wasn’t thinking about scoring. I just let the game come to me,” Dioubate said. “Coach put me in with a few minutes left in the game because Jarin (Stevenson) fouled out and I just tried to play as hard as I can and let my defense contribute to offense, and that’s what I did.”

RJ Davis scored 20 points to help UNC beat the Spartans 85-69 on Saturday, pushing the Tar Heels to the Sweet 16 while keeping them unbeaten in March Madness against Izzo's teams in a series going back 26 years.

Harrison Ingram made five 3-pointers and scored 17 points for the West Region’s top seed, which continued its NCAA success in its home state. The Tar Heels (29-7) improved to 5-0 in the tournament against Izzo, including victories in the 2005 Final Four and 2009 title game.
